Low Cement Castable 50
Low Cement Castable 50 Specification
- Purity(%)
- Al2O3 content: 50 - 55%
- Density
- 2.7 Gram per cubic centimeter(g/cm3)
- Form
- Castable, supplied dry - mix with water before use
- Water Absorption
- 7%
- Usage & Applications
- Used for lining high temperature zones due to its high mechanical strength and resistance to abrasion
- Melting Point
- Above 1750C
- Chemical Composition
- Al2O3, SiO2, CaO, minor Fe2O3
- Hardness (%)
- Not applicable (monolithic castable)
- Application
- Furnaces, Kilns, Boilers, Incinerators, Lining of combustion chambers
- Surface Finish
- Smooth after casting and setting
- Product Type
- Refractory Castable
- Types of Refractories
- Low Cement Castable
- Shape
- Powder (monolithic, castable form)
- Porosity
- 13 - 16%
- Dimensional Stability
- Excellent, minimal shrinkage at high temperatures
- Strength
- Cold Crushing Strength (CCS) 70 MPa
- Specific Gravity
- 2.7 - 2.8
- Thermal Conductivity
- 1.6 - 1.9 W/mK at 1000C
- Color
- Gray
- Grain Size
- 0-5 mm
- Bonding System
- Calcium aluminate cement bonded
- Compressive Strength after firing at 1500C
- 80 MPa
- Maximum Service Temperature
- 1550C
- Shelf Life
- Up to 6 months in dry storage
- Installation Method
- Vibration casting or hand casting
- Setting Time
- Initial: 4-6 hours, Final: 6-8 hours
- Bulk Modulus of Rupture
- 8.0 MPa after drying at 110C
- Abrasion Resistance
- High, suitable for areas prone to mechanical wear
- Packaging
- 25 kg or 50 kg moisture-proof bags

FAQ's of Low Cement Castable 50:
Q: How is Low Cement Castable 50 installed for furnace lining?
A: Low Cement Castable 50 is installed using vibration casting or hand casting methods. The supplied dry powder should be thoroughly mixed with the specified amount of water, poured into formwork, and then vibrated or casted manually to achieve a dense, smooth lining.Q: What benefits does this low cement castable offer for high wear zones?
A: It delivers potent abrasion resistance and high cold crushing strength, making it ideal for areas exposed to mechanical wear, such as furnace linings, kilns, and combustion chambers.Q: When should I use Low Cement Castable 50 instead of traditional refractory materials?
A: Choose Low Cement Castable 50 when applications demand superior strength, reduced cement content, excellent dimensional stability, and resistance to high temperatures and abrasion, particularly in industrial environments.Q: Where is this product manufactured and supplied from?
